A Look Back in Time: Memoir of a Military Kid in the Fifties, Vol. I is a heartfelt, humorous, and vivid journey through the eyes of Bernard N. Lee, Jr., as he reflects on his childhood in a military family during one of the most transformative decades in American history. From dusty farms to bustling army bases, young Bernard's life was shaped by three-year cycles of relocation, new schools, and the ever-present challenge of saying hello-and goodbye-to new friends. This coming-of-age story captures the joys and struggles of being a military kid, especially one growing up Black in 1950s America.
